On June 19, 2026, the Department of Finance Canada announced a 10 percent surtax on global imports of canned vegetables, effective immediately.
This surtax is directly related to the safeguard inquiry that began in March, 2026. The Canadian Government has cited concerns over threats to the Canadian canned vegetable industry.
The Canadian International Trade Tribunal intends to continue the inquiry through to September 9, 2026, at which point it will provide additional recommendations and appropriate remedies. Unless extended, the provisional surtax is set to end at that 200-day mark.
Affected Commodities: Global imports of certain canned vegetables, excluding goods originating from the United States, Mexico, Israel, Chile, and developing countries.
Guidance on the application of this safeguard surtax is still forthcoming from the relevant government agencies.
